The Edward T. LeBlanc Memorial Dime Novel Bibliography

Series - Flag Series

Language:English
Publisher: Street & Smith (New York (N.Y.): 39 Rose St.) -- United States
Category: Format : Reprint Library
Issues: 14 (Highest number seen advertised)
Dates: January 25, 1896 to Aug. 8, 1896
Schedule: Semi-monthly
Price: 25ยข
Size: 7 x 5"
Pages: 200 to 250
Illustrations: Pictorial colored cover
Publisher's Blurb: "What patriotic American does not honor our noble standard, Old Glory? And who is there who does not love to read of noble deeds, brave adventures and perilous escapes in the defense of our flag and country, with the side lights of love and comedy deftly interspersed?"
